Okegiga Homes, is one of the most favored Resort in the World’s biggest river Island Majuli. Established in November, 2017 by two aspiring Entrepreneurs, who seek to bring a change in the Tourism scenario to cater the need of the new generation travelers like Digital Nomads, Location Independent entrepreneurs, Artists, Painters, Social Entrepreneurs, Backpackers, Budget travelers, the students and others. The space The Resort is located in a very serene environment with its surroundings occupied by a lovely woods and tiny river Kherkuti suti. The early morning is always beautiful with the rising sun and chirpings of the birds from the woods. And at night, sitting on the ground or the balcony of your cottage just gaze the stars and lost yourself. Of course, do not forget to make your wish when you witness the shooting star. The space is unique as it is the one and only accommodation, in Majuli, with different types of accommodation facilities viz, Traditional Bamboo Cottage, Wooden Cottage, Concrete hall/dormitory, Swiss Tent Cottage and Camping Tents. It has the river Lohit on the front while on the side you can enjoy the lovely wood.

G Mann wrote a review Dec 2018
5.0 of 5 bubbles
This is a beautiful peaceful place, on a wonderful island. Dip was very kind and helpful and patient. And so we’re all the staff. The food was very tasty and they even went off menu and made a variety of very tasty local dishes. The beds were very comfy, and the surrounding nature is gorgeous. What can I say, we loved it. In addition to this, we went on some great walks - if you take a right outside of Okegiga and keep right it takes you to a river with a bamboo bridge (10 INR toll charge) and the road to the old (no longer in use) Khabolu River Ferry Point (2.5 hour walk) is an incredible walk through nature, tribal villages and past some amazing lakes - animals and beautiful birds a plenty. We spent 4 nights here and it was great. The people on the island are very lovely and helpful and eager to say hello. Have fun.

Answer from Explorer A
From Jorhat railway station you need to come to Neemati Ghat, Jorhat (20km apprx) for crossing Brahmaputra river by ferry. Catch the ferry for Kamalabari ghat, Majuli. Once you reach Kamalbari Ghat you can have available shared vehicles to Garamur. It is just 1 Km from Garamur to the property. You can connect me at 8822390306.
